Practical Guidance for Using Antigua Coast
Adopting a new script font into your toolkit requires some thoughtful consideration. First, always test it in the context of your specific project. Mock up a logo, create a sample social media post, or lay out a page of your newsletter. Does the font’s personality align with your message? A playful, modern script might not be the best fit for a law firm’s website, but it could be perfect for a children’s clothing line.
Next, consider font pairing. Antigua Coast, with its decorative nature, pairs best with clean, simple typefaces. A neutral sans serif font for body text or a classic serif font for subheadings can provide a beautiful contrast that enhances both fonts. The goal is balance—let Antigua Coast be the star of the show for key elements, and use its partner font to support and ensure overall readability.
Review the included styles and glyphs. Many premium fonts come with alternates, ligatures, and swashes. Exploring these can help you customize the look further and avoid a generic appearance. For instance, swapping out a standard ‘t’ for a more ornate alternate can make a word in a logo feel truly unique.
Readability is paramount. Test the font at the size it will be viewed. At very small sizes, some of the finer connecting strokes might merge. Ensure there’s enough contrast between the text and its background. For digital use, check its rendering on different screens.
